提示信息

电子导盲犬的挑战:从技术到用户体验的路障

韦宝宝 已关注

电子导盲犬作为辅助视障人士出行的创新技术,其发展过程中面临着一系列挑战。这些挑战不仅涉及技术层面,还包括用户体验和其他方面的问题。以下是一些主要的障碍:

  1. 精确的环境感知

    • 电子导盲犬需要能够准确感知并理解复杂的环境。即使是微小的错误感知也可能导致危险情况。准确的障碍物检测、实时的路径规划、以及复杂多变的城市环境理解都是巨大的技术挑战。
  2. 传感器的可靠性和成本

    • 高精度传感器(如激光雷达、摄像头或超声波传感器)的成本可能较高,影响产品的普及和性价比。此外,天气条件(如雨雪)或光线变化(如白天与夜晚)对传感器的有效性也提出了挑战。
  3. 人工智能算法的优化

    • 为了处理大量传感器数据并做出实时决策,电子导盲犬需要强大的人工智能算法。这些算法需要在各种场景下经过广泛的训练和验证,以确保可靠性和安全性。
  4. 电池寿命和设备耐用性

    • 长时间的使用需求对设备的电池寿命和整体耐用性提出了高要求。尤其在户外环境中,设备需要具备良好的抗震、防水和耐用性。
  5. 用户体验和信任问题

    • 要让视障人士完全信任电子导盲犬,需要提供高度可靠和直观的用户体验。这包括简单易用的界面、易于理解的语音提示,以及迅速的响应时间。
  6. 道德和隐私问题

    • 电子设备通常需要采集大量数据,这可能带来隐私泄露的风险。需要严格的数据保护措施和透明的隐私政策来确保用户的信息安全。
  7. 社会接受度和法规合规

    • 电子导盲犬的广泛采用还需要面对社会接受度的问题,包括对新技术的认知以及相关法规的制定和合规性。
  8. 个性化与可适应性

    • 每位视障人士的需求可能不同,需要具备个性化设置和学习能力的电子导盲犬,以适应各种使用者的偏好和需求。

克服这些挑战需要多方面的努力,包括技术创新、用户反馈的持续整合、政策支持以及社会对辅助技术的意识提升。通过这些努力,电子导盲犬才能真正成为视障人士的得力助手。

    遇到难题? "AI大模型GPT4.0、GPT" 是你的私人解答专家! 点击按钮去提问......
韦宝宝 关注 已关注

最近一次登录:2024-11-19 18:02:22   

暂时还没有签名,请关注我或评论我的文章

丢丢
10月30日

环境感知的技术难度很大,希望能有更好的解决方案!

时光: @丢丢

环境感知的确是设计电子导盲犬时面临的一大挑战。为了提高电子导盲犬在复杂环境中的表现,手段可能可以从多模态传感器融合的角度来考虑。例如,结合使用激光雷达(LiDAR)、摄像头和超声波传感器,使系统能够获取更全面的环境信息。

一种可能的实现方法是利用深度学习模型进行图像识别,然后结合LiDAR数据进行空间理解。可以考虑使用TensorFlow或PyTorch来构建一个卷积神经网络(CNN),以下是一个简单的示例代码片段:

import tensorflow as tf
from tensorflow import keras
from tensorflow.keras import layers

model = keras.Sequential([
    layers.Conv2D(32, (3, 3), activation='relu', input_shape=(128, 128, 3)),
    layers.MaxPooling2D(pool_size=(2, 2)),
    layers.Conv2D(64, (3, 3), activation='relu'),
    layers.MaxPooling2D(pool_size=(2, 2)),
    layers.Flatten(),
    layers.Dense(128, activation='relu'),
    layers.Dense(num_classes, activation='softmax')
])

通过训练这样的模型,可以提高系统对环境的理解能力,进而增强导盲功能。可以参考这篇文章 Sensor Fusion for Autonomous Vehicles 来获取关于传感器融合的更多思路和方法。

探索不同的技术组合,或许会帮助提升电子导盲犬的环境感知能力,从而更好地满足用户的需求。

3天前 回复 举报
袅与
11月03日

对传感器可靠性的担忧很重要,例如,在恶劣天气下如何确保传感器正常工作?

文道寺: @袅与

在讨论电子导盲犬的传感器可靠性时,确实有必要关注极端天气对性能的影响。比如,雨雪天气可能导致传感器的视野受限,这对定位和避障功能是个挑战。实现冗余传感器系统可能是一个可行的解决方案。

可以考虑使用多种类型的传感器组合,例如激光雷达、小型摄像头和超声波传感器,这样在某一传感器失效或受到干扰时,其他传感器仍然能够维持系统的正常运行。以下是一个简化的代码示例,展示如何在传感器数据采集时实现这种冗余机制:

class Sensor:
    def get_data(self):
        # 模拟返回传感器数据
        pass

class LidarSensor(Sensor):
    def get_data(self):
        # 返回激光雷达数据
        return "Lidar Data"

class CameraSensor(Sensor):
    def get_data(self):
        # 返回摄像头数据
        return "Camera Data"

class UltrasonicSensor(Sensor):
    def get_data(self):
        # 返回超声波传感器数据
        return "Ultrasonic Data"

class Handler:
    def __init__(self):
        self.sensors = [LidarSensor(), CameraSensor(), UltrasonicSensor()]

    def collect_data(self):
        data = []
        for sensor in self.sensors:
            try:
                data.append(sensor.get_data())
            except Exception as e:
                print(f"Error collecting data from {sensor.__class__.__name__}: {e}")
        return data

# 使用
handler = Handler()
sensor_data = handler.collect_data()
print(sensor_data)

此外,考虑到传感器在不同天气条件下的表现,随着智能算法的发展,系统可以通过不断学习和优化来调整传感器的工作模式。例如,利用机器学习模型预测特定天气条件下的传感器有效性和适用性,可能会更好地适应环境变化。

关于传感器各种技术和应用的研究,推荐参考 IEEE Xplore 来获取最新的科研文章与技术解决方案。

刚才 回复 举报
偏爱他
11月09日

AI算法的训练需要大量数据,特别是复杂环境下的反馈,如何解决这个问题?

苍白: @偏爱他

针对AI算法在复杂环境下需要大量数据的问题,可以考虑使用数据增强技术来扩充训练集。通过模拟各种环境变化,例如不同的天气条件、照明情况,甚至各种障碍物的布局,可以生成额外的训练样本。这不仅能提高算法在实际场景中的泛化能力,还能在一定程度上缓解数据不足的问题。

例如,利用Python中的图像处理库PIL(Pillow),可以迅速创建经过旋转、裁剪或颜色变换后的图像。以下是一个简单的代码示例,展示如何进行图像增强:

from PIL import Image, ImageEnhance
import numpy as np

def augment_image(image_path):
    img = Image.open(image_path)

    # 旋转图像
    img_rotated = img.rotate(15)  # 旋转15度
    img_rotated.save('augmented_rotated.jpg')

    # 调整亮度
    enhancer = ImageEnhance.Brightness(img)
    img_brighter = enhancer.enhance(1.5)  # 增加亮度
    img_brighter.save('augmented_brighter.jpg')

    # 添加噪声
    noise = np.random.normal(0, 25, img.size)
    noisy_img = np.array(img) + noise.reshape(img.size[1], img.size[0], 3).astype(np.uint8)
    Image.fromarray(np.clip(noisy_img, 0, 255)).save('augmented_noisy.jpg')

# 使用示例
augment_image('original_image.jpg')

此外,可以建立与用户的反馈机制,将用户在使用电子导盲犬时的具体体验反馈整合进训练过程中,形成一个闭环的改进体系。可以参考这个项目的思路:Using Augmented Reality in AI Systems。这样不仅帮助模型更好地适应实际使用场景,同时也增强了用户的参与感。

21小时前 回复 举报
旧人归
11月11日

我觉得电池和设备耐用性是关键,使用寿命长短直接影响用户体验!

缠绵: @旧人归

在讨论电子导盲犬的用户体验时,电池的持续时间和设备的耐用性确实不可忽视。一个理想的解决方案应能够在各种环境条件下保持良好的功能,同时提供相对较长的使用寿命。

例如,考虑到户外使用环境,设备的防水和抗震设计也非常重要。开发者可以参考现代智能穿戴设备的电池管理系统,通过采用节能算法来延长电池使用时间。下面是一个简单的伪代码示例,描述一种可能的电池优化策略:

def optimize_battery_usage(sensor_data):
    if sensor_data['light'] < threshold:
        activate_low_power_mode()
    else:
        normal_mode()

这种基本策略通过根据环境光线条件来调节设备的工作模式,能够有效延长电池寿命,从而改善用户体验。

此外,用户在使用电子导盲犬时,设备的重量和舒适性也是关键因素。在设计时,应优先考虑轻量材料,并进行长时间佩戴的舒适性测试。

建议参考以下网址,了解更多关于智能设备电池优化的内容:Battery University

通过不断完善这些技术和设计,才能确保用户在依赖电子导盲犬时,获得更顺畅和舒适的体验。

刚才 回复 举报
桃花醉
3天前

用户界面的友好性很重要,尤其是对视障人士的可操作性设计。应该引入更多语音交互!

冷酷到底: @桃花醉

在设计电子导盲犬的用户界面时,确实需要充分关注界面的友好性和对视障人士的可操作性。使用语音交互能够为用户提供更为直观和无障碍的操作体验。例如,可以通过实现文本转语音(TTS)技术来朗读给用户的信息,这样就能大大增强其互动性。

import pyttsx3

engine = pyttsx3.init()
engine.say("前方有障碍物,请小心行驶。")
engine.runAndWait()

上述代码展示了如何使用Python中的 pyttsx3 库来实现简单的语音提示。这样的功能可以提供实时反馈,使用户在行走时能更好地了解周围环境。此外,还可以考虑引入手势识别技术,允许用户通过简单的手势来访问特定功能,从而进一步提升操作的便捷性。

关于参考资料,可以查阅国外一些成功案例,如Thalmic Labs的Myo手环,它通过手势控制提供了高效的交互体验。希望在未来的开发中,能考虑更多这类创新的交互方式。

4小时前 回复 举报

隐私问题必须重视,可以通过加密技术保护用户数据,这样才能增强用户的信任感。

花落后: @咖啡不加糖

在讨论隐私问题时,可以考虑运用一些先进的加密算法来保护用户数据。例如,使用AES(高级加密标准)对敏感信息进行加密,这样即使数据被截获,攻击者也无法轻易解读。以下是一个使用Python实现AES加密的简单示例:

from Crypto.Cipher import AES
import base64

def encrypt(plain_text, key):
    # 填充数据至16字节倍数
    while len(plain_text) % 16 != 0:
        plain_text += ' '
    cipher = AES.new(key.encode('utf-8'), AES.MODE_ECB)
    encrypted = cipher.encrypt(plain_text.encode('utf-8'))
    return base64.b64encode(encrypted).decode('utf-8')

# 使用16字节密钥进行加密
key = "thisisasecretkey"
plain_text = "Sensitive user information."
encrypted_text = encrypt(plain_text, key)
print(f"加密后的数据: {encrypted_text}")

此外,结合用户体验设计,需明确告知用户其数据如何被使用及保护措施。可通过隐私政策或用户协议详细说明,并提供便于理解的示例说明,增强用户的信任感。关于隐私保护的设计原则,可以参考设计隐私的原则。这种方法不仅保障了用户的隐私安全,还提升了技术的用户接受度。

刚才 回复 举报
刹那
刚才

社会接受度的提升需要时间和教育。媒体宣传和真实案例能帮助提高公众的认可度!

沦陷的痛: @刹那

在讨论电子导盲犬的挑战时,社会接受度的确是一个核心问题。教育和宣传的作用不容小觑,尤其在新的技术尚未完全被理解时。以社交媒体作为传播渠道,可以分享真实的用户体验和案例,让公众更加直观地了解电子导盲犬的优点和应用场景。

例如,可以通过制作短视频,展示电子导盲犬在不同环境中的表现,帮助人们看见这些技术如何提高视觉障碍人士的生活质量。此外,开发一个互动性的网页,展示电子导盲犬如何工作,并邀请用户分享他们的体验和看法,这样的方式或许能够促进对这一技术的更深了解。

以下是一些可能的参考资料,可以帮助了解电子导盲犬的现状以及用户体验的重要性:

通过这些方式,或许能够在社会上营造一个更开放的氛围,让更多人理解和接受这一重要技术。

4天前 回复 举报
精灵王
刚才

个性化设置非常有意思,可以考虑使用机器学习提升导盲犬的适应能力,以满足不同用户的需求。示例代码:

class GuideDog:  
    def train(self, user_preferences):  
        # 针对用户偏好的训练逻辑
        pass

温柔眼眸: @精灵王

可以考虑进一步探讨如何利用数据收集和分析来增强电子导盲犬的智能化程度。除了机器学习,实时反馈机制或许也可以对用户体验产生积极影响。通过收集用户在使用过程中的数据,系统能够不断调整和优化其性能,从而更好地满足各类用户的需求。

例如,可以设计一个建议反馈机制,通过用户直接输入或选择操作偏好进行个性化调整:

class GuideDog:
    def __init__(self):
        self.user_preferences = {}

    def train(self, user_preferences):
        self.user_preferences.update(user_preferences)

    def update_preferences(self, new_preferences):
        # 更新用户的新偏好
        self.train(new_preferences)
        print("用户偏好已更新:", self.user_preferences)

此外,使用API与其他设备协作,比如智能手机或智能家居设备,可以为用户提供更全面的支持,让电子导盲犬更有效地融入用户的日常生活。可以参考 OpenAI的机器学习实践 以获取灵感和相关技术支持。这样的多方位整合可能会为用户带来更顺畅的使用体验。

4天前 回复 举报
幻灭
刚才

法规的合规性十分关键,相关政策的制定应该引导技术的发展,确保用户安全!

签歌无颜: @幻灭

在考虑电子导盲犬的技术挑战时,法规合规性无疑是一个不可忽视的方面。确保用户安全与技术发展的平衡,的确需要政策的引导。例如,可以设立一个专门的评审委员会,负责评估和认证每项新入市的辅助技术。

创建一种标准化的评估框架或许是一个可行的方向。这个框架除了涵盖基本的功能和安全性,还可以考虑用户的实际体验和反馈。例如,可以使用用户参与的测试小组,收集不同用户在使用过程中遇到的实际障碍,从而逐步完善产品。

class GuideDogPolicy:
    def __init__(self, technology):
        self.technology = technology
        self.user_feedback = []

    def collect_feedback(self, feedback):
        self.user_feedback.append(feedback)

    def evaluate_compliance(self):
        # Evaluating user safety and technology compliance
        for feedback in self.user_feedback:
            if not feedback['safety_compliant']:
                return False
        return True

相关政策的制定还可以借鉴一些领域的最佳实践,例如自动驾驶汽车的法规体系,这些体系综合了技术发展、安全性及用户体验等多个方面。

具体来说,可以参考International Journal of Human-Computer Studies,了解更多关于技术与用户体验间的关系,进而推广更有效的政策框架。

前天 回复 举报
凌波微步
刚才

要让电子导盲犬真正有效,团队需要跨领域合作,从技术到伦理都要考虑全面!

泓煜: @凌波微步

在设计电子导盲犬的过程中,确实考虑跨领域合作是一个非常重要的方面。从技术层面来看,融合的传感器技术与人工智能算法必须考虑到行人的行为、环境的变化以及用户本身的需求。这可以通过构建一个多模态数据处理系统来实现,例如使用Lidar和摄像头结合实时图像处理,以识别障碍物和导航路径。

import cv2
import numpy as np

def detect_obstacles(frame):
    # 使用OpenCV进行障碍物检测
    gray = cv2.cvtColor(frame, cv2.COLOR_BGR2GRAY)
    edges = cv2.Canny(gray, 50, 150)
    contours, _ = cv2.findContours(edges, cv2.RETR_EXTERNAL, cv2.CHAIN_APPROX_SIMPLE)

    for contour in contours:
        if cv2.contourArea(contour) > 500:  # 过滤小的噪声
            x, y, w, h = cv2.boundingRect(contour)
            cv2.rectangle(frame, (x, y), (x+w, y+h), (0, 255, 0), 2)
    return frame

从用户体验的角度,确保电子导盲犬的反馈机制直观而友好也是极为重要的。例如,可以通过震动和声音来提示使用者不同类型的障碍物,从而提升识别能力。一个推荐的方法是通过用户测试来收集实际反馈,使得产品不断迭代优化。

更多关于跨领域合作的具体案例可以参考以下链接:IEEE Cross-Disciplinary Innovations,这个资源提供了一些关于不同领域之间合作如何推动创新的实例和启示。

刚才 回复 举报
×
免费图表工具,画流程图、架构图